Action item: The Relayn deploy-status bot silently dropped updates when the pipeline API paginated results, so responders believed a rollback had completed when it had not. We will add pagination handling, a staleness banner, and an integration test. Until merged, verify deploy state directly in the pipeline console, documented at the page below.

runbook for kahop-kajop: https://rundeck.ordinio.test/display/secrets/pipeline/issue/pages/repo/browse/e5732776e07d1285107e5aeb

## MergeMuse Environments

MergeMuse dedupes customer records nightly across staging and prod. Staging points at a scrubbed copy of the Tindervale dataset, so don't panic if match rates look weirdly high there. If dedupe jobs stall, check the matcher queue before restarting anything. The prod matcher reads its thresholds and batch sizes from the values below.

settings of tagef-bawif:
DRUIX_HOST=druix.zemvarlabs.internal
DRUIX_PORT=8000

The stale-branch cleanup bot (Brushcutter v2.3) failed its signature check during last night's sweep of the Larkspur monorepo. Verification rejected the release artifact with a digest mismatch, so no branches were pruned. I compared the artifact against the build from the Fernwick CI pool and the binary is intact; the issue is that verification is still pinned to the retired key from the June rotation. To unblock, please re-sign the artifact with the current release key, reproduced below:

release key, fajef-kajeg: bky19_LdLu6Ne6FLi8he2c24d